Premiere Stages at Kean University Announces 2017 Season
by A.A. Cristi
- Apr 26, 2017
For the first time in its 13-year history, Premiere Stages will provide expanded development to five new works in one season, including the New Jersey Premiere of Skeleton Crew, the third play in Dominique Morisseau's critically acclaimed Detroit cycle, and the first professional production of Chris Cragin-Day's heartwarming play, Foster Mom, winner of the 2017 Premiere Stages Play Festival. This season will also feature free developmental workshops of Patricia Cotter's 1980 (Or Why I'm Voting For John Anderson), runner-up for the 2017 Play Festival, and two exciting new play commissions, Nicole Pandolfo's Brick City, developed in cooperation with NJPAC and the New Jersey Theatre Alliance, and Martin Casella's Black Tom Island, recipient of the 2017/2018 Liberty Live Commission in partnership with Liberty Hall Museum. Tickets go on sale May 22.

Loose TEA Theatre Presents A Re-Imagining of Bizet's Classic Opera CARMEN
by BWW
News Desk
- Nov 22, 2016
On November 22, 2016, at Club 120 in Toronto, Loose TEA Theatre presents a radically re-visioned Carmen-a refreshing change from the familiar perspective of Bizet's opera. Carmen is often classed as one of the few elite works in the Western music tradition that occupies the mantle of collective cultural memory - and is performed unchanged. With a new English libretto by Alaina Viau, and with the collaboration of sound artist SlowPitchSound, Carmen will be presented not as a love story, but a class story. It is a gendered story, one that is driven by inequality and abuses of power-by conflict, struggle, and hope.
